Transaction 66ae1229eb91cb31623800185790cf01814c654e2127306e581649ab9c82f835

1 Input
2 Outputs
  • 66ae1229eb91cb31623800185790cf01814c654e2127306e581649ab9c82f835:0
  • value  6199668
    address  2NEnU7q44PFfJhFyabgfuJmBKPXobWTgHvN
  • 66ae1229eb91cb31623800185790cf01814c654e2127306e581649ab9c82f835:1
  • value  1000000
    address  2Mw3BNvBjdbQuCxmFggR2XrasebkJfzBKDE